Our Team's Vision:

Illumio’s Cloud Secure team builds and operates the data backbone that powers our AI-driven Security Graph — a system that maps the world’s most complex cloud environments in real time. 
We ingest and process petabytes of cloud metadata and network flow logs from AWS, Azure, GCP, and OCI cloud environments using high throughput streaming applications. This data fuels our graph analytics and Zero Trust segmentation engine, giving customers deep visibility and precise control across billions of workloads.

Our SaaS platform spans multi-cloud environments and leverages a modern tech stack of Golang, Kafka, Neo4j, Postgres, and advanced data lake technologies that are all containerized and orchestrated at scale.

As an intern, you’ll work at the intersection of large-scale data engineering, distributed systems, and cybersecurity analytics, contributing to systems that help secure the world’s most critical workloads.
